Bali, known as the Island of the Gods, is a popular tourist destination in Indonesia. The island’s beautiful beaches, temples, and culture make it a perfect place for a vacation rental business. However, running a vacation rental business in Bali can be challenging. Here are some tips to help you succeed in the Bali property for rent market:

Understand the local laws and regulations

Before starting a vacation rental business in Bali, it’s important to understand the local laws and regulations. This includes obtaining the necessary licenses and permits to operate your business. Failure to comply with these laws can result in fines or even the closure of your business.

Look for property for rent in Bali in good locations

The location of your vacation rental can make or break your business. Popular tourist areas such as Seminyak and Ubud tend to be more expensive, but also attract more visitors. Consider the location when you are looking for property for rent in Bali and what type of traveler you want to attract. If you’re looking for a more peaceful and secluded location, a property rental in a residential area may be a better option.

Invest in quality furnishings and amenities

When it comes to vacation rental properties, first impressions count. Invest in quality furnishings and amenities to make your property stand out. From comfortable beds to a well-equipped kitchen, guests will appreciate the attention to detail. This can help increase the occupancy rate of your property, which means more revenue for your business.

Use professional photography and marketing

High-quality photographs are essential to attract guests to your Bali property rental. Hire a professional photographer to take pictures of your property. Then use these pictures to market your property on vacation rental websites, social media and other platforms.

Offer excellent customer service

Providing excellent customer service is key to running a successful vacation rental business in Bali. This includes responding promptly to inquiries, providing detailed information about the property and the local area, and being available to answer any questions or concerns that guests may have.

Build relationships with other owners of property for rent in Bali

Networking with other rental owners can be beneficial to your business. You can learn from their experiences, get advice on how to run your business, and even collaborate on marketing efforts. This can help increase your visibility and attract more guests to your property.

Optimize your pricing strategy

Pricing your property correctly is crucial to the success of your Bali property rental business. This means finding the right balance between affordability and profitability. Research the prices of similar properties in the area to determine a competitive rate. Keep in mind that peak season and holidays tend to be the most expensive times to rent out a property, while low season and off-peak times may require lower prices to attract guests.

Establish a strict cleaning and maintenance schedule

Maintaining the cleanliness and upkeep of your property is crucial to keeping guests happy and coming back. Establish a strict cleaning and maintenance schedule to ensure that your property is always in top condition. This includes regular cleaning and sanitization, as well as regular checks for any repairs or maintenance needs.

Utilize online booking and payment systems

To make it easy for guests to book and pay for your property, consider utilizing online booking and payment systems. These systems allow guests to easily view availability, make reservations, and pay for their stay all in one place. This can save you time and increase the efficiency of your business. Additionally, it can also offer an extra layer of security and protection for both guests and property owners.
